## Overview

Trump Media proposed a $100,000-per-month commercial service to deliver real-time feeds of the U.S. president’s social media posts — a monetization play leveraging proximity to political communication infrastructure.

### TL;DR

- Trump Media offered a premium feed service for presidential posts at $100K/month
- The offering targets clients needing speed-advantaged access to official political messaging
- No confirmation of launch, adoption, or technical implementation is provided in the report

## Reader Risk

**Evidence Strength:** low  
Report relies entirely on unnamed 'sources'; no documentation, email, slide deck, or internal memo is cited or quoted.  
**Verification Status:** Unclear / Unverified  
**Narrative Risk:** moderate  
If the pitch is unsubstantiated or misrepresented, it could trigger reputational damage for Trump Media as opportunistic or misleading — especially given prior scrutiny over disclosure practices and SEC filings.  
**AI Repetition Risk:** moderate  
**What AI Will Probably Repeat:** Trump Media pitched a $100,000/month service for the fastest feed of U.S. president's posts.  
AI systems may drop the qualifier 'sources say' and present the pitch as confirmed fact, omitting its speculative, unverified nature and lack of implementation.  
**Counter-Frame (Media):** Framed as a vanity play lacking technical substance or regulatory grounding — exploiting political attention without delivering infrastructure value.  
**Missing Voices:** Trump Media spokesperson, National Archives and Records Administration (NARA), Federal Communications Commission (FCC) staff, Competing data vendors (e.g., Bloomberg, Reuters)  

### Questions Not Answered

- Which clients were approached and what was their response?
- What technical architecture enables 'fastest feed' — API, scraping, direct integration, or proxy?
- Has any regulatory review been sought for distributing official communications via private commercial channel?
